Key Components of a Security Guard Resume in Bendigo

When it comes to securing a position as a security guard, crafting an engaging resume is essential. Below are crucial components that should be included in your security guard resume in Bendigo:

1. Contact Information

Make sure to place this information at the top of your resume:

  • Full Name
  • Phone Number
  • Email Address
  • LinkedIn Profile (if applicable)

This clear approach ensures prospective employers can easily reach out to you.

2. Professional Summary

Your professional summary serves as an elevator pitch, briefly summarizing your skills and experience relevant to the role of a security guard.

Example:

"Dedicated and vigilant security professional with over five years of hands-on experience in providing safety for commercial properties and events in Bendigo. Proven track record of maintaining high levels of vigilance while assisting patrons with inquiries."

3. Skills Section

Highlighting specific skills tailored for the security sector underscores what you bring to potential employers.

Key Skills Include:

  • Strong observational abilities
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Crisis management
  • Conflict resolution
  • First-aid certification
  • Knowledge of surveillance systems

4. Work Experience

Your work history should feature relevant roles, responsibilities, and achievements that showcase your suitability for the job.

Format:

  1. Job Title: Security Officer

    • Company Name, City (Month/Year – Month/Year)
    • Responsibilities:
      • Monitored premises through regular patrols.
      • Managed access control procedures ensuring only authorized personnel were allowed entry.
      • Responded promptly to alarms and incidents while documenting occurrences accurately.
  2. Job Title: Event Security Staff

    • Company Name, City (Month/Year – Month/Year)
    • Responsibilities:
      • Ensured patron safety during various events with crowds exceeding 500 attendees.
      • Coordinated effectively with local law enforcement when necessary.
      • Provided exceptional customer service by addressing guest inquiries.

The Importance of Tailoring Your Resume

Tailoring your security guard resume in Bendigo can significantly enhance its impact — this means personalizing it according to the job description provided by potential employers. Current trends indicate that hiring managers prefer resumes which address specific requirements stated in their listings.

How To Tailor Your Resume?

  1. Highlight relevant experience according to job posting details.
  2. Use terminology mentioned by employers; they often contain keywords recruiters use during applicant scans.
  3. Showcase local achievements or recognized training obtained from institutions within Bendigo or nearby areas.

FAQ Section

Q: What qualifications do I need as a security guard?

A: Basic qualifications often include obtaining a Certificate II or III in Security Operations alongside first aid certifications depending on employer demands.

Q: Is it necessary to include all my previous jobs on my resume?

A: No! Focus on positions relevant within the last ten years related specifically toward any roles involving public safety or conflict mediation.

Q: How long should my security guard resume be?

A: Ideally one page; two pages maximum if strongly justified by ample experience worth listing elaborately!
